The United States has conducted an attack on an Iranian military site, escalating tensions in the Middle East. This strike follows former President Donald Trump's denial of any agreement related to the Strait of Hormuz, raising questions about the current U.S. administration's policy towards Iran.

The attack, which targeted an Iranian military facility, reflects growing American concern over Iranian activities in the region, which Washington views as a threat to regional security. U.S. officials indicated that this strike aims to send a clear message to Tehran that the United States will not tolerate any threats to its national security.

Details of the Attack

According to military sources, the attack was carried out using drones and precision missiles, resulting in significant destruction of the targeted facility. There have been no reports of casualties among Iranian forces; however, the attack provoked angry reactions from Iranian officials who deemed it a blatant violation of their sovereignty.

At the same time, Trump reiterated in his statements that there is no agreement regarding the Strait of Hormuz, complicating the situation further. These statements serve as confirmation that U.S. policy towards Iran remains unclear, leaving room for multiple interpretations.

Background & Context

Historically, the Strait of Hormuz has been a site of ongoing tensions between the United States and Iran, as it is one of the world's most crucial maritime passages, through which approximately 20% of global oil passes. Recent years have seen numerous incidents that escalated tensions between the two sides, including attacks on oil tankers and acts of sabotage.

It is noteworthy that relations between Iran and the United States have significantly deteriorated since Trump's withdrawal from the Iranian nuclear deal in 2018, leading to the imposition of severe economic sanctions on Tehran. These sanctions have had a profound impact on the Iranian economy and exacerbated internal conditions.

Impact & Consequences

The U.S. attack on the Iranian military site could lead to further escalation of tensions between the two countries and may open the door to potentially violent Iranian responses. Iran is likely to intensify its military activities in the region, increasing the risk of armed conflict.

Additionally, this attack may affect U.S. relations with its allies in the region, as some allies may feel concerned about the rising tensions, while others might see this as an opportunity to strengthen their alliances against Iran. At the same time, this escalation could increase pressure on the current U.S. administration to reassess its policy towards Iran.

Regional Significance

Given the current situation, the rising tensions between the United States and Iran could directly impact neighboring Arab countries, especially those that rely on the Strait of Hormuz for oil transportation. Any military escalation could disrupt maritime navigation, affecting the global economy.

Moreover, this situation could lead to increased divisions within the region, as some countries may take differing stances on the U.S. escalation. It is crucial for Arab nations to stay informed about developments and work to enhance their internal stability to face any potential repercussions.
